About

Simone Marcella is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Simone Marcella has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 351 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Immunology, 5 papers in Molecular Biology and 4 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Simone Marcella's work include Mast cells and histamine (3 papers), Coagulation, Bradykinin, Polyphosphates, and Angioedema (3 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). Simone Marcella is often cited by papers focused on Mast cells and histamine (3 papers), Coagulation, Bradykinin, Polyphosphates, and Angioedema (3 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). Simone Marcella coll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Hungary and Ireland. Simone Marcella's co-authors include Stefania Loffredo, Gilda Varricchi, Maria Rosaria Galdiero, Mariantonia Braile, Leonardo Cristinziano, Anne Lise Ferrara, Luca Modestino, Giancarlo Marone, Gianni Marone and Angelica Petraroli and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Immunology,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Environment International.
